There are a number of events in the ministry of Jesus that are documented by more than one Gospel author. Events that are documented by two authors (Matthew and Mark, Matthew and Luke, or Mark and Luke) are called the “double tradition.” Events that are described by three Gospel writers (Matthew, Mark, and Luke) are called the “triple tradition.”[1] One of the ways in which liberal skeptics attack the historical reliability of the Gospel books is to point out that there are differences in the double and triple tradition.
